独立新风变风量系统在负压隔离病房平疫转换中的应用
Application of independent outdoor air variable air volume systems in epidemic conversion of negative pressure isolation wards
摘要:
平疫转换病房空调系统应满足普通病房、负压病房和负压隔离病房的不同规范要求。梳理了不同的医院设计规范对各类型病房的空调系统设计参数要求,包括室内温湿度、换气次数、新风量、压力控制、气流组织、过滤等级等。总结了平疫转换病房设计参数要求。在普通变风量系统的基础上,提出了独立新风变风量系统,并以某病房为例进行了分析,给出了不同病房模式的控制策略。
Abstract:
The air conditioning system of epidemic conversion wards should meet the different standard requirements of general wards, negative pressure wards and negative pressure isolation wards. Sorts out the design parameters of air conditioning system for each type of wards according to different hospital design standards, including indoor temperature and humidity, air change rate, outdoor air rate, pressure control, air distribution, filtration classification and so on. Summarizes the design parameter requirements of the epidemic conversion wards. On the basis of ordinary VAV systems, proposes an independent outdoor air VAV system, and taking a ward as an example, suggests the control strategies of different ward modes.
